objective c - tamaño - El cambio programático del tipo de teclado en iOS no hace nada
teclado iphone descargar (1)
Prueba esto:
-(BOOL)textFieldShouldReturn:(UITextField *)textField
{
[textField setKeyboardType:UIKeyboardTypeNumbersAndPunctuation];
[textField reloadInputViews];
return YES;
}
Quiero cambiar el tipo de teclado de forma predeterminada a numérico después de que el usuario presione el botón de retorno. Sin embargo, después de configurar la propiedad keyboardType no pasa nada.
Mi código:
-(BOOL)textFieldShouldReturn:(UITextField *)textField
{
[textField setKeyboardType:UIKeyboardTypeNumbersAndPunctuation];
return YES;
}
Me he establecido como delegado de campo de texto y se llama al método después de presionar el botón de retorno.
EDITAR: resuelto por
-(BOOL)textFieldShouldReturn:(UITextField *)textField
{
[textField setKeyboardType:UIKeyboardTypeNumbersAndPunctuation];
[textField reloadInputViews];
return YES;
}